How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Berkeley County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Berkeley County Studio Apartments | $1,000 | $775 | $1,250 |
| Berkeley County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,260 | $549 | $1,849 |
| Berkeley County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,571 | $595 | $2,004 |
| Berkeley County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,104 | $1,399 | $2,865 |
| Berkeley County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,621 | $2,514 | $2,689 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Berkeley County
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Berkeley County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Berkeley County ranges from $549 to $1,849 with an average monthly rent of $1,260.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Berkeley County c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Berkeley County range from $595 to $2,004.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,571.
How expensive are Berkeley County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 33 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Berkeley County on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,399 to $2,865 - averaging $2,104 for the location.
